Irish rap group Kneecap canceled their 15-date US tour in October due to a band member's upcoming court hearing in London. The hearing concerns charges of displaying a Hezbollah flag at a previous concert, which the band denies. While disappointed, Kneecap plans a larger future tour and promises a special announcement for US fans next week. The cancellation follows controversy at Coachella over their statements criticizing the Israeli government's actions in Gaza, leading to accusations of antisemitism, which the band refutes.
